MANDY TRIPCONY

NT Representative (Darwin)

DARWIN

Mandy joins Mayvin Global in 2025 as our on the ground representative in the Northern Territory. She has been based in Darwin for the past 15 years. Mandy has managed a diversity of projects and has extensive events management experience across a breadth of sectors including Indigenous arts, tourism, sport, and agriculture.

Mandy is passionate about supporting regional, rural, and remote communities highlighted in her work for the Darwin Aboriginal Art Fair Foundation from 2015 - 2022, as General Manager and more recently as NT Farmers Association Projects Administrator. Mandy’s commitment to the non-profit sector further underscores her dedication to creating opportunities for social and economic advancement. With a practical and hands-on approach to capacity building and networking, Mandy is committed to helping communities and organisations develop strategies that ensure long-term impact. Her work values succession planning, fostering thoughtful growth, and embedding operational practices that promote organisational longevity.

Through her collaborative approach, Mandy fosters meaningful relationships and supports initiatives that empower communities with the aim to leave a legacy of positive change and sustainability.
